Cómo cambiar el cálculo del resultado de error al usar la fórmula de Vlookup a 0 o una celda vacía en Microsoft Excel

Tabla de contenido

A veces, obtenemos un error o cero como resultado al aplicar la fórmula de Vlookup. Obtenemos el error # N / A cuando todos los valores de búsqueda no están disponibles en los datos, y obtenemos cero cuando el valor de búsqueda está disponible pero la celda de selección está en blanco.

En este artículo, aprenderemos cómo podemos cambiar el resultado mientras aplicamos la fórmula de Vlookup en Microsoft Excel.

Para resolver este problema, usaremos las funciones IF, ISERROR y Vlookup.

ISERROR La función nos ayuda a verificar el error y devolverá el resultado como verdadero o falso.

SI La función dará la condición sobre la base de la función ISERROR.

Tomemos un ejemplo para entender: -

Tenemos 2 conjuntos de datos de empleados. En los primeros datos, tenemos detalles, como la fecha de incorporación, el nombre y la designación del empleado, y en 2Dakota del Norte datos, solo tenemos códigos de empleado y queremos elegir la fecha de incorporación a través de la función Vlookup.

Comencemos usando la función Vlookup en los datos: -

  • Ingrese la fórmula en la celda G2
  •  = BUSCARV ($ F3, $ A $ 3: $ D $ 13,2, FALSO) 
  • Presione Entrar.
  • Copia la fórmula en el resto de celdas.

Ahora puede ver en la imagen de arriba que pocas celdas tienen el resultado, pero pocas celdas tienen el error # N / A y la primera celda muestra 0.

Para evitar errores, utilice la función según el procedimiento siguiente: -

  • Ingrese la fórmula en la celda H2
  •  = SI (ISERROR (BUSCARV ($ F3, $ A $ 3: $ D $ 13,2, FALSO)), "", BUSCARV ($ F3, $ A $ 3: $ D $ 13,2, FALSO)) 
  • Presione Entrar
  • Copia la fórmula en el resto de celdas.

Ahora puede ver que en lugar de mostrar errores, las celdas aparecen en blanco.

Para evitar el cero, utilice la función según el procedimiento siguiente: -

  • Ingrese la fórmula en la celda H2
  •  = SI (BUSCARV ($ F3, $ A $ 3: $ D $ 13,2, FALSO) = 0, "", BUSCARV ($ F3, $ A $ 3: $ D $ 13,2, FALSO) 
  • Presione Entrar
  • Copia la fórmula en el resto de celdas.

Para evitar el cero y el error juntos, aplique la siguiente función: -

  • Ingrese la fórmula en la celda H2
  •  = SI (ESERROR (BUSCARV ($ F3, $ A $ 3: $ D $ 13,2, FALSO)), "-", SI (BUSCARV ($ F3, $ A $ 3: $ D $ 13,2, FALSO) = 0, "-", BUSCARV ($ F3, $ A $ 3: $ D $ 13,2, FALSO))) 
  • Presione Entrar
  • Copia la fórmula en el resto de celdas.

De esta forma, podemos utilizar funciones para resolver nuestras consultas sobre Microsoft Excel.

Nota: - En una versión posterior de Microsoft Excel 2003, tenemos la función IFERROR para obtener el mismo resultado. Esta fórmula es compatible con todas las versiones de Microsoft Excel.

Si te gustaron nuestros blogs, compártelo con tus amigos en Facebook. Y también puedes seguirnos en Twitter y Facebook.
Nos encantaría saber de usted, háganos saber cómo podemos mejorar, complementar o innovar nuestro trabajo y hacerlo mejor para usted. Escríbenos a sitio de correo electrónico

Anteriorpróximo

Comentarios

  1. Aiden
    26 de agosto de 2013 a las 10:26 am

    La cadena nula "" no es lo mismo que una celda vacía. Esto todavía se evalúa a 0 si se usa en cálculos posteriores.

    Responder ↓

Deja una respuesta Cancelar respuesta

Su dirección de correo electrónico no será publicada. Los campos obligatorios están marcados *

Comentario

Nombre *

Correo electrónico *

Va a ayudar al desarrollo del sitio, compartir la página con sus amigos

wave wave wave wave wave